What is Chelated Zinc?
Chelated zinc is a form of zinc that is bound to amino acids or other organic compounds, which helps improve its absorption in the body. The term “chelation” refers to the process of forming a complex between a metal ion and a molecule, which facilitates better transport and utilization of the mineral. This is particularly beneficial for individuals who may have difficulty absorbing standard zinc supplements.
The Importance of Zinc in the Body
Zinc is vital for various bodily functions, including:
1. Immune Function: Zinc is essential for the proper functioning of immune cells. Adequate zinc levels help the body fend off infections and reduce the duration of illnesses.
2. Wound Healing: Zinc plays a significant role in skin health and repair. It is involved in collagen synthesis and inflammatory response, making it crucial for wound healing.
3. DNA Synthesis: As a cofactor for several enzymes, zinc is necessary for DNA and RNA synthesis, which is vital for cell division and growth.
4. Taste and Smell: Zinc is critical for the proper functioning of taste and smell receptors. A deficiency can lead to alterations in these senses.
Benefits of 25 mg Chelated Zinc
1. Enhanced Absorption: The chelation process enhances the bioavailability of zinc, making it easier for the body to absorb and utilize. This is especially important for individuals with digestive issues or those who follow a vegetarian or vegan diet, as plant-based sources of zinc are often less bioavailable.
2. Optimal Dosage: A dosage of 25 mg is generally considered safe and effective for most adults. This amount can help meet the daily recommended intake without the risk of toxicity, as excessive zinc can lead to adverse effects.
3. Supports Immune Health: Regular supplementation with 25 mg chelated zinc can bolster the immune system, helping to prevent common colds and infections, especially during peak seasons.
4. Promotes Skin Health: For individuals dealing with acne or other skin conditions, chelated zinc may help by reducing inflammation and supporting the skin’s healing process.
5. Cognitive Function: Zinc is known to play a role in cognitive functions. Adequate levels of zinc can support memory and learning, making it beneficial for both children and adults.
